Transaction 76c5b333ee7020116eb9fac5953772cff48f6534a29aed225e26d41eb1bfc59d

2 Input
1 Outputs
  • 76c5b333ee7020116eb9fac5953772cff48f6534a29aed225e26d41eb1bfc59d:0
  • value  512143
    address  1HDWAto9mD4vwZkxE7RZ4nxvgYcA5vJQpG